Brighton's dense urban environment and harsh New England winters lead to frequent issues like suspension damage from potholes, brake wear from stop-and-go traffic, and corrosion from road salt. Battery failures are also common during cold snaps, making these key services for local repair shops.

Seek immediate diagnostics if the light is flashing, indicating a severe problem. For a steady light, schedule an appointment promptly, as delaying can worsen issues, especially before navigating Boston's busy streets or a long commute. Many Brighton shops offer same-day code reading.
Labor rates in Brighton are competitive with Greater Boston, which can be higher than suburban rates due to urban overhead. However, getting multiple estimates from local shops is wise, as pricing for common services like brakes or oil changes is often transparent and competitive within the neighborhood.
Consider your parking situation; some shops offer loaner cars or shuttle services, which is valuable if you rely on street parking. Also, factor in Boston's seasonal street cleaning bans and snow emergencies, as you may need your vehicle moved or require quicker turnaround times during these periods.
